Afrojack ready to span genres in Hollywood

One young producer who’s found an ever-growing EDM space in America is Nick van de Wall, the 24-year-old DJ who performs as Afrojack. Even non-EDM fans have probably heard his work, as he’s helmed Pitbull and Ne-Yo’s hands-up single “Give Me Everything” and Beyoncé’s drum-clattering smash “Run the World” with producer-peers Diplo and the-Dream. The tens of thousands of people who caught his set on Electric Daisy Carnival’s main stage reveled in his genre-spanning mixes, in which sandblasted bass lines dissolved into fizzy trance anthems, which bumped up against hard house and Europhile sleekness.
